High-grade tile, slate, standing-seam steel, and concrete roof assemblies quit warm transfer successfully. Property owners must make certain specialists seal all roof side gaps with non-combustible bird quits or metal blinking. Eliminating open spaces under roofing floor tiles stops wind-driven cinders from getting in the underlying roofing framework.Exactly How Does Siding Option Avoid Thermal Warmth Transfer?Non-combustible exterior house siding creates a durable barrier that shows high radiant heat and withstands straight flames. Products such as thick traditional stucco, concrete panels, and high-density fiber cement do not stir up when subjected to extreme thermal radiation. Setting up an underlying fireproof sheath under the main house siding adds a critical additional defense layer. This multi-layered outside wall method maintains internal structural framework secure during intense heat exposure.Modern Architectural Facts That Block Traveling EmbersRefining subtle architectural details gets rid of concealed collection factors where wind-blown embers usually collect throughout a wildfire. Specialized vents including great mesh testing block ashes while preserving required attic room air flow. These corrosion-resistant metal screens stop particles as small as one-sixteenth of an inch from entering internal attic room rooms. Updating exterior ventilation points protects hidden roof covering rooms from inner ignition.What Window and Door Features Resist Extreme Warmth Direct Exposure?Dual-pane windows geared up with tempered outside glass withstand breaking under severe warmth anxiety much better than basic stiff glass. Multi-pane home window assemblies maintain convected heat from firing up indoor home window treatments or furnishings. Strong fire-rated exterior doors including durable weather removing block draft pathways that could draw embers right into living areas. Picking reinforced steel or fiberglass door frameworks ensures architectural integrity during thermal occasions.Producing Defensible Space in Coastal Residential SetupsEstablishing defensible space around a Santa Monica residential property lowers straight flame exposure and decreases offered gas near the main house. Homeowner can incorporate hardscaping features with drought-tolerant, fire-retardant plant species to balance aesthetic beauty with useful defense.Just How Should Homeowner Structure Home Ignition Zones?House owners need to preserve a zero-ignition zone prolonging 5 feet out of the foundation utilizing gravel, concrete pavers, or rock attractive rock. The immediate five-foot boundary should stay entirely devoid of flammable mulch, wood fencing, or thick greenery. The additional protection zone, expanding thirty feet from the home, calls for low-growing plants, well-irrigated turf, and extensively spaced trees. Getting rid of dead organic matter continuously maintains gas levels marginal throughout both areas.Which Native Plant Kingdoms Support Fire Resistance and Coastal Charm?Fire-retardant plants feature high moisture material, low sap volume, and very little leaf losing throughout seasonal climate shifts. Species such as agave, succulent ranges, California lilac, and ingrained groundcovers absorb warmth without stiring up swiftly. Preventing resinous plants like eucalyptus, ache, and ornamental grasses protects against rapid flame spread out near living areas. Integrating hardscape retaining walls and stone sidewalks develops natural firebreaks throughout exterior rooms.Frequently Asked Questions About Coastal FireproofingWhat Is one of the most Prone Part of a Coastal Home Throughout a Wildfire?Roof covering assemblies and open outside vents represent the solitary most prone access factor for flying embers.
